Question
the height of an equilateral triangle is $4sqrt{3}$. what is the perimeter of the equilateral triangle?
12 units
24 units
$24sqrt{3}$ units
$12sqrt{3}$ units
Step1: Recall height - side relation
For an equilateral triangle with side length $a$, the height $h=\frac{\sqrt{3}}{2}a$. Given $h = 4\sqrt{3}$.
Step2: Solve for side length
Set $\frac{\sqrt{3}}{2}a=4\sqrt{3}$. Cross - multiply to get $\sqrt{3}a = 8\sqrt{3}$. Divide both sides by $\sqrt{3}$, then $a = 8$.
Step3: Calculate perimeter
The perimeter $P$ of an equilateral triangle is $P = 3a$. Substitute $a = 8$ into the formula, so $P=3\times8=24$.
